The machine flake's git-tracked settings file is system state, not
"theme" only — rename it to state.json. CLI becomes nomarchy-state-sync
with a nomarchy-theme-sync symlink for scripts and muscle memory.
Eval (mkFlake, doctor, lifecycle) still accepts theme-state.json; the
next write migrates to state.json and removes the legacy file.
Documented in MIGRATION.md; drop the CLI alias after release notes.
Ghostty's OpenGL 4.3 floor broke the Acer (HD 4000 / 4.2). Dual-terminal
support (default Ghostty + install-time Kitty fallback) was more complexity
than it was worth.
- Remove ghostty.nix / nomarchy.ghostty.enable
- Kitty always installed and themed from theme-state
- Default nomarchy.terminal = kitty; SUPER+Return, doctor, calendar,
what-changed use kitty --class=com.nomarchy.*
- Drop install-time glxinfo probe and mesa-demos on the installer
- Docs/REQUIREMENTS no longer list OpenGL 4.3 as a terminal floor
Verified: V0 flake check; option-docs; installer-safety; template HM has
kitty, no ghostty; menu/calendar emit classed kitty launches.

A git-tracked agent/ directory so AI agents can iterate on the distro
unattended (runner-agnostic: /loop, headless claude -p, or a fresh
manual session — all state lives in the checkout, per the distro's own
philosophy):
- LOOP.md — the iteration protocol: orient → pick one BACKLOG task →
verify up the V0–V3 ladder → commit+push main → record. Safety rails
(v1 untouchable, no force-push, no surprise lock bumps) and
stop-and-escalate conditions.
- BACKLOG.md — the forward half of docs/ROADMAP.md reworked into a
prioritized queue (5 NOW / 6 NEXT / LATER / PROPOSED / Decisions);
ROADMAP.md stays the design/decision record + shipped log.
- GOALS.md — the four pillars (stable > reproducible/zero-hidden-state >
effortless config > beautiful), quality bars, non-goals.
- CONVENTIONS.md — coding/design rules (in-flake state, menu placement,
Waybar whole-swap parity, toggle-vs-package, no formatter).
- MEMORY.md — curated hard-won lessons (VM recipes, btrfs-assistant
segfault watch, rofi/WirePlumber/hyprlock gotchas).
- HARDWARE-QUEUE.md — every pending V3 on-hardware check collected from
the ROADMAP, with exact steps, split by machine.
- JOURNAL.md — append-only iteration log, seeded with this bootstrap.
Plus a root CLAUDE.md entry point and README/ROADMAP pointers.
Verified: V0 — docs-only; nix flake check --no-build green.
